Instructions

Step 1

Have the ingredients prepped before beginning since everything will cook quickly.

Step 2

Begin by mixing the sauce. If using medjool dates, use a small high speed blender to blend together the dates, water, coconut aminos and rice vinegar. Then stir in the sesame oil, garlic, ginger, and arrowroot. If using date syrup or honey, you can simply whisk the ingredients together in a bowl. Set aside.

Step 3

Place the chicken pieces on a cutting board or in a large bowl and sprinkle all over with the salt, pepper, and arrowroot, then drizzle with the coconut aminos and toss to coat.

Step 4

Heat a large non stick skillet or wok over medium high heat and add one tablespoon of the oil. Once sizzling, add the chicken in a single layer and let them cook for a minute or until browned. Stir and cook the chicken for another 2 minutes or until fully cooked and golden brown all over. Remove to a plate and set aside.

Step 5

Add one tablespoon of oil to cook the veggies and keep the heat on medium high. Add the white scallions, carrots and peppers and cook, stirring often, for 1-2 minutes or until barely fork tender.

Step 6

Add the blanched broccoli to the skillet followed by the cooked chicken and sauce. Stir to coat the chicken and veggies in the sauce. The sauce should thicken right away, cook another 30 seconds to heat through and combine flavors. Serve hot, over fried cauliflower rice or alone. Enjoy!
